Hereof What steroid did Andreea test positive for? SYDNEY, Australia — This isn’t a sinister case of an athlete pumping herself full of steroids or human growth hormone. Andreea Raducan isn’t Ben Johnson. At 4-foot-10 and 82 pounds, her slight body is hardly bulging with muscles. Romanian gymnast Andreea Raducan’s first test sample came back positive for stimulants.

Who won the 2008 women’s gymnastics all-around? Nastia Liukin delights the crowd with a spectacular performance to win the Olympic gymnastics individual all-round with 63.325 points, more than a half-point ahead of her teammate, friend and world champion Shawn Johnson.

Is pseudoephedrine banned in gymnastics? He also said pseudoephedrine is not banned by the International Gymnastics Federation. However, the IOC’s banned drug list governs Olympic competition. … She is not capable of such a thing as doping,” Dana Encutescu, federal secretary of the Romanian Gymnastic Association, told Romanian media.

Who was in the 2016 gymnastics Olympics?

The five members of the team were Simone Biles, Gabby Douglas, Laurie Hernandez, Madison Kocian, and Aly Raisman, with MyKayla Skinner, Ragan Smith, and Ashton Locklear serving as the three alternates.

Who won women’s all-around gymnastics 2016? The women’s artistic team all-around competition at the 2016 Summer Olympics was held on 9 August 2016 at the HSBC Arena. The United States finished first in qualifications and then won the event final by over eight points. It was the USA’s second consecutive Olympic team gold.

Why is methylphenidate a banned substance? The stimulant methylphenidate (Ritalin), for example, is often prescribed to treat ADHD in children and young adults but its use is prohibited in sport by the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A) because it may enhance explosiveness, power, strength or stamina.

Does methylphenidate affect cognition?

The studies reviewed here show that single doses of MPH improve cognitive performance in the healthy population in the domains of working memory (65% of included studies) and speed of processing (48%), and to a lesser extent may also improve verbal learning and memory (31%), attention and vigilance (29%) and reasoning …

What happens if you take methylphenidate without ADHD? Summary: New research has explored the potential side effects of the stimulant drug Ritalin on those without ADHD showed changes in brain chemistry associated with risk-taking behavior, sleep disruption and other undesirable effects.

How does methylphenidate make you feel? As stimulant drugs, methylphenidate and the methylphenidate-based drugs can make you feel very ‘up’, awake, excited, alert and energised, but they can also make you feel agitated and aggressive. They may also stop you from feeling hungry.

Is there ADHD in Japan? The prevalence of adult ADHD is estimated as 1.65% in Japan [3] and 1.2 to 3.2% [2, 4] worldwide. Thus, a substantial number of adults have ADHD symptoms.

Can I take dexamphetamine to Japan? Typically, these ingredients are only in meds that are prescribed by a doctor or would need a special identity check with a pharmacist. According to the embassy, if you bring any of the following medicines into Japan you will be arrested: Dexamphetamine (used for ADHD, Narcolepsy, etc.)

Is ADHD illegal in Japan? Amphetamines and methamphetamines such as Adderall, a medication for attention deficit hyperactivity disorder that is approved in the U.S., are strictly illegal in Japan. There is no way to bring them in.
